UNSIGNED bands from across East Anglia could be sharing the stage with some of the biggest names in the music industry next summer – if an aspiring music promoter gets his wish.

Chris Anson is planning a huge festival to be held at the Bentwaters Air Base site, near Woodbridge, in July.

And he would like to attract huge names with strong local links to headline the Great Eastern Music Festival – including Blur, from Colchester, and Busted, whose member Charlie Simpson comes from Woodbridge.

Mr Anson, who formed an organisation called Feast of the East to highlight the talents of local bands, plans to showcase up to 20 unsigned groups over the three-day festival.

"Original bands just don't get a fair deal round here because everyone wants to hear covers, so creativity goes out the window," said Mr Anson, who is based in Great Yarmouth.

"I see this festival as an ideal way to show off some of our best local bands and give them exposure at the highest possible level.

"I think music in this area is booming. There are so many great bands – but no-one is taking any notice of them.

"That is something I want to change."

Mr Anson is waiting to hear from the teams behind the big name stars, but is hopeful of securing as many as possible.

He added: "It would be great to have a real top name to headline the gig. Blur, for example, are a class act, they have been the top East Anglian band for more than a decade, and they persistently create music of the highest quality.

"I think the festival is going to be great for the area. We've already had 50 tapes sent in from unsigned bands.

"It's creating a lot of excitement in East Anglia and it should do – it's about time we had something like this to look forward to."
